A concave polygon will always have at least one reflex interior anglethat is an angle with a measure that is between 180 degrees and 360 degrees exclusive. In geometry a convex polygon is a polygon that is the boundary of a convex setThis means that the line segment between two points of the polygon is contained in the union of the interior and the boundary of the polygon.
